Publisher's summary

Cambridge, 1944. Bill Anderson is a restless young fighter pilot who finds himself grounded for a week. He can't wait to get back in the sky where he belongs. But fate has other plans. He strays into a stuffy college library and happens on Mary Rice, a spirited bluestocking who takes his breath away. Before long, the spark between them deepens into true love. But their time together can't last forever. All too soon, Bill is torn from Mary's side and sent back to the battlefield. Then the unthinkable happens. Bill's plane is shot down and Bill himself is missing presumed dead. It's Mary's worst nightmare come true, but she won't give up on her sweetheart now she's found him.
